The most to least vulnerable Democratic held US Senate seats up for re-election in 2024.

WV(Manchin-D)
MT(Tester-D)
OH(Brown-D)
AZ(Sinema-D or Gallego-D)
MI(Stabenow-D)
NV(Rosen-D)
WI(Baldwin-D)
ME(King-I)
PA(Casey-D)
VA(Kaine-D)
NJ(Menendez-D)
NM(Heinrich-D)
WA(Cantwell-D)
CT(Murphy-D)
MN(Klobuchar-D)
DE(Carper-D)
NY(Gillibrand-D)
MA(Warren-D)
CA(OPEN Feinstein-D)
RI(Whitehouse-D)
MD(Cardin-D)
VT(Sanders-I)
HI(Hirono-D)

The most vulnerable Republican held US Senate seats up for re-election in 2024.
TX(Cruz-R) if the Democratic nominee is Julian Castro or Scott Kelly.
MS(Wicker-R) if the Democratic nominee is Jim Hood-D.(Jim Hood served 4 terms as MS State Attorney General, Ran for Governor of MS in 2019/lost in the November General Election to then Lt Governor Tate Reeves by a 5 percent margin.
IN(OPEN Braun-R) If the Democratic nominee is Frank Mvran-D.
